Responsibilities
- Plans, designs and oversees the reconfiguration, maintenance, and alteration of equipment, machinery, buildings, structures, and other facilities.
- Gathers and reviews data concerning facility or equipment specifications, company or government restrictions, required completion date, and construction feasibility.
- Collaborates with architecture/engineering firms in developing design criteria and preparing layout and detail drawings.
- Prepares bid sheets and contracts for construction and facilities acquisition.
- Reviews and estimates design costs including equipment, installation, labor, materials, preparation, and other related costs.
- Inspects or directs the inspection of construction and installation progress to ensure conformance to established drawings, specifications, and schedules.
